Gate News Bot news, on November 17, according to CoinMarketCap data, as of the time of writing, COAI (ChainOpera AI) is currently priced at $0.76, falling 9.91% in the last 24 hours, with a highest price of $1.20 and a lowest price of $0.72. The current market capitalization is approximately $143 million, a decrease of $15.7261 million compared to yesterday.

2️⃣ Fully diluted valuation exceeds $4 billion
Although the current market capitalization is approximately $143 million, COAI's fully diluted valuation has exceeded $4 billion. This valuation reflects investors' optimism about ChainOpera AI's long-term development potential, while also indicating that it may face significant inflationary pressures in the future.
